If you stay to the right at the "Y" to Gatekeeper, you end up on Odessa Canyon. If you take Gatekeeper, it turns into Doran Canyon. The bypass to the Gatekeeper for Doran is on the left when you first come into the valley from the road off the highway. It takes up top and along the ridge then drops you into Doran Canyon just above the Gatekeeper.
